Three charges, q1=-10 μC,q2=4 μC and q3=10 μC are aligned vertically, 6 cm apart. Point P is located 8 cm directly to the right of q2. 1.) Find the electric field contribution from q1 on point P. A. -9 MN/C                C. -14.0625 MN/C B. -25 MN/C              D. -12 MN/C 2.) Find the electric field contribution from q2 on point P. A. 5.625 MN/C           C. 14.06 MN/C B. 3.6 MN/C                D. 10 MN/C 3.) Find the electric field contribution from q3 at point P. A. 12 MN/C                 C. 9 MN/C B. 25 MN/C                 D. 14.0625 MN/C 4.) Find the magnitude of the net electric field at point P due to all three charges. A. 23.625 MN/C         C. 5.625 MN/C B. 21.6 MN/C              D. 12.18 MN/C
